Domaine Belargus Quarts de Chaume Grand Cru 'Rouères', Loire, France 2018 Sabaté and Coca It offers lovely citrus-bright fruitQuarts de Chaume Grand Cru 'Roures' from Domaine Belargus, botrytized Chenin Blanc from a legendary Anjou site. Quince, apricot, honey, saffron and citrus; lusciously sweet yet vibrant, with piercing acidity and a long finish. 95 Pts Wine Advocate
